Description
Trimagnesium phosphate hydrate was synthesized by mechanochemical reaction of a slurry of magnesium hydrogen phosphate trihydrate and magnesium oxide with the molar ratio of 2:1 in a pot mill for a few hours. Mg3(PO4)2⋅8H2O was obtained by using a slurry with more than 60wt% water; Mg3(PO4)2⋅22H2O, with 40wt% water. The anhydrate of trimagnesium phosphate was obtained by heating Mg3(PO4)2⋅8H2O or Mg3(PO4)2⋅22H2O above 700°C.
